The following words and phrases as used in this
plan shall have the meaning set forth in this article, unless a different
meaning is otherwise clearly required by the context:
ACCOUNT OR ACCRUED BENEFIT
The fair market value of a participant's individual account as determined on each valuation date. Adjustments to the account which will be recognized for any purpose hereunder between each valuation date shall only include distributions from the account and employee contributions under §
60-78. All other adjustments shall only be recognized as of a valuation date.
ACT
The Municipal Pension Plan Funding Standard and Recovery
Act (enacted as Act 205 of 1984), as amended, 53 P.S. § 895.101
et seq.
AUTHORIZED LEAVE OF ABSENCE
Any leave of absence granted in writing by the employer for
reasons including, but not limited to, accident, sickness, pregnancy
or temporary disability, education, training, jury duty or such other
reasons as may necessitate authorized leave from active employment.
"Authorized leave of absence" shall include any period of absence
from employment for the purpose of serving in the Armed Forces of
the United States of America, provided the employee returns to employment
at the time and under the circumstances which provide reemployment
rights pursuant to federal or state law.
BENEFICIARY
The person or entity designated by the participant to receive
such benefits as may be due hereunder upon the death of the participant.
In the event that a participant does not designate a beneficiary or
the beneficiary does not survive the participant, the beneficiary
shall be the surviving spouse, or if there is no surviving spouse,
the issue, per stirpes, or if there is no surviving issue, the estate;
but if no personal representative has been appointed, to those persons
who would be entitled to the estate under the intestacy laws of the
commonwealth if the participant had died intestate and a resident
of the commonwealth.
BOARD
The Board of Commissioners for the Township of South Fayette.
CHIEF ADMINISTRATIVE OFFICER
The person designated by the employer who has the primary
responsibility for the execution of the administrative affairs for
the plan.
CODE
The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ended.
COMPENSATION
The base remuneration, whether salary or hourly wages, paid
to an employee by the employer for services rendered in employment.
Compensation shall exclude all extra or additional forms of remuneration,
including but not limited to bonuses, overtime pay, commissions, or
expense reimbursements. Compensation shall be limited on an annual
basis for purposes of this plan to the amount specified pursuant to
Code § 401(a)(17), as adjusted under Code § 415(d).
CONTINUOUS EMPLOYMENT
A.
An employee's period or periods of uninterrupted
employment with the employer. For purposes of this section, employment
shall not be deemed interrupted by any periods of authorized leave
of absence. In the event an employee does not return to employment
at the conclusion of an authorized leave of absence, the employee
shall be deemed to have terminated employment as of the last day on
which the employee rendered active service for the employer.
B.
Continuous employment shall also include any period of qualified military service as determined under the requirements of Chapter
43 of Title 38, United States Code, provided that the participant returns to employment following such period of qualified military service, and the participant makes payment to the plan in an amount equal to the participant contributions that would otherwise have been paid to the plan during such period of qualified military service. The amount of participant contributions shall be based upon an estimate of the compensation that would have been paid to the participant during such period of qualified military service as determined by the average compensation paid to the participant during the 12 months immediately preceding the period of qualified military service. The amount of participant contributions so calculated must be paid into the plan before the end of the period that begins on the date of re-employment and ends on the earlier of the date that ends the period that has a duration of three times the period of qualified military service, or the date that is five years after the date of re-employment.
CONTRACT OR POLICY
A retirement annuity or retirement income endowment policy
(or a combination of both), or any other form of insurance contract
or policy which shall be deemed appropriate in accordance with the
provisions of the Act.
EARLY RETIREMENT AGE
The later of the date that an employee attains age 60 or
completes 25 years of service.
EFFECTIVE DATE
The date upon which the provisions of this plan were first
effective, that is, June 3, 1970.
EMPLOYEE
Any person who is regularly employed as a full-time employee
by the employer other than police or members of a collective bargaining
unit whose retirement benefits are the subject of negotiation with
the employer unless a negotiated collective bargaining agreement provides
for coverage under this plan.
EMPLOYER
The Township of South Fayette, Allegheny County, Pennsylvania.
EMPLOYMENT
Any period of time during which an employee renders services
for the employer for which the employee is entitled to receive compensation.
Employment shall not include any period of time during which an individual
performs services as an independent contractor paid on a contractual
or fee basis.
ENTRY DATE
An employee’s first scheduled workday immediately following the employee’s completion of the eligibility requirements in Article
XIV.
[Amended 1-13-2016 by Ord. No. 1-2016]
HOUR OF SERVICE
Each hour for which an employee is entitled to compensation
for employment. Hours of service may be imputed and calculated in
a manner consistent with the requirements of Department of Labor regulations
found at § 2530.200(b).
PARTICIPANT
Any employee who has commenced participation in this plan in accordance with Article
XIV, and has not for any reason ceased to participate hereunder.
PENSION FUND
The fund administered under the terms of this plan, which
shall include all assets, including but not necessarily limited to
money, property, investments, policies and contracts standing in the
name of the plan.
PLAN
The Township of South Fayette Non-Union Employees' Pension
Plan set forth herein.
PLAN YEAR
The twelve-month period beginning on January 1 and ending
on December 31.
RESTATEMENT DATE
January 1, 2001, the date on which the provisions of this
restated plan are effective.
RETIREMENT DATE
The first day of the month coincident with or next following the date when an employee terminates employment and is eligible for payment of a benefit hereunder pursuant to Article
XIX.
TOTAL AND PERMANENT DISABILITY
A.
A condition of physical or mental impairment
due to which a participant is unable to perform any customary duties
of employment, which continues for a period of at least six months,
which shall be expected to be permanent and continuous for the remainder
of the life of the participant, and due to which the participant shall
be eligible to receive Social Security disability benefits.
B.
Notwithstanding any other provisions of the
plan to the contrary, a participant shall not be deemed to incur a
total and permanent disability under the plan if the condition of
physical or mental impairment results from alcoholism or addiction
to narcotics, participation in a felonious criminal enterprise, an
intentionally self-inflicted injury, or service as a member of the
armed services of any country. The Plan Administrator shall make all
relevant determinations under this paragraph based upon the facts
and circumstances relevant to each such determination.
YEAR OF SERVICE
Each completed twelve-month period of continuous employment
with the employer. Each period of continuous employment shall be aggregated
with all other periods of continuous employment and calculated as
whole years and fractions thereof rounded to the nearest completed
month.
